Qualifications

Qualifications:Advanced degree in Engineering, Finance, or a related field. Extensive experience in technical due diligence or related advisory roles within the infrastructure sector.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with the ability to synthesize complex data into actionable insights. Proven leadership capabilities and experience managing multidisciplinary teams. Exceptional communication and interpersonal skills, with a track record of cultivating strong client relationships. Proficiency in project management methodologies and tools.

Key Responsibilities

Driving Strategic Growth:

  • Foster the growth of the TDD Practice in alignment with overarching business objectives by identifying new opportunities, driving revenue, and enhancing market presence;
  • Serve as a technical and thought leader both internally and externally;
  • Collaborate with organizational leadership to execute strategic planning, sales, and marketing strategies.

Lead the TDD Market:

  • Technical Due Diligence Leadership: Spearhead and deliver technical due diligence assessments for Transport, Energy, and Social assets, including conducting site evaluations to gauge asset condition, performance, and associated risks.
  • Project Management: Oversee multi-disciplinary teams across diverse geographies, languages, time zones, and cultures, integrating external experts and internal colleagues to provide high-quality, timely, and cost-effective solutions.
  • Client Advisory: Convert technical insights into actionable recommendations for investors and stakeholders. Collaborate with Financial, Traffic & Revenue, and Environmental, Social and Governance due diligence teams to create cohesive reports.
  • Risk Assessment: Analyze and assess technical and operational risks associated with infrastructure assets, including contractual agreements, construction methodologies, operational maintenance, lifecycle planning, and propose strategies for risk mitigation.
  • Reporting & Communication: Develop comprehensive, client-ready reports and presentations tailored for investor audiences, ensuring effective communication of findings.
